Documentation ¶ Index ¶ type Metrics func NewMetrics() (*Metrics, error) func (m *Metrics) QueryDurationObserve(dbType, dbAddr, dbName, operation string, isError bool, since time.Duration) func (m *Metrics) SerializationFailureInc(dbType, dbAddr, dbName string) Constants ¶ This section is empty. Variables ¶ This section is empty. Functions ¶ This section is empty. Types ¶ type Metrics ¶ type Metrics struct { // contains filtered or unexported fields } func NewMetrics ¶ func NewMetrics() (*Metrics, error) nolint:promlinter // skip milliseconds. func (*Metrics) QueryDurationObserve ¶ func (m *Metrics) QueryDurationObserve(dbType, dbAddr, dbName, operation string, isError bool, since time.Duration) func (*Metrics) SerializationFailureInc ¶ func (m *Metrics) SerializationFailureInc(dbType, dbAddr, dbName string) Source Files ¶ View all Source files metrics.go Click to show internal directories. Click to hide internal directories.